November 19, 1950
Dearest Betty

No mail today our mail is all fouled up. Probably the F.P.O. heard the rumor that we were leaving and sent our mail back
Eh?

Well we are moving steadily forward and getting colder by the day. Lots of snow. Tire chains are the uniform of the day for vehicles on the mountain. Korean Katy has a new name, Priapism, medical name for permanent erection. (she has changed her gender) The Doctor named it that. Boy does the old boat run good now with the new motor etc. all put on. Started it up today at noon and right away Tate wanted to go to Ord. 45 miles to Hamhung ---so off we go! Was dark when we got back and very cold

Will have to find Washey Washey Wonson tomorrow and get my gear all cleaned up cause we will be going up on the Plateau soon. Yet, I know of no news, Honey everything is O.K. a little shooting but not too much---mostly snipers. Have to have a blackout every nite but we have our windows all covered with canvas. We got new stove today and of course we have a fuel shortage but our stove burns diesel so we keep warm.

Well nite nite Sugar , I love you lots & lots

Your Bill
